"American Town" is a song by English singer-songwriter Ed Sheeran, taken from his seventh studio album Autumn Variations, released on 29 September 2023, through Gingerbread Man Records. It was sent to Italian contemporary hit radio on the same day as the album by Warner Records as its lead single.[1] Sheeran wrote the song with producer Aaron Dessner.

Composition and lyrics

"American Town" has been described as a "de facto sequel" to Sheeran's 2017 single, "Galway Girl". In "American Town", Sheeran sings about falling in love with an "English girl" in an American Town and the two getting "Chinese food in small white boxes, live a life we saw in Friends".[2] The song also contains sung-rapped vocals from Sheeran and lyrics about walking in the cold with dungarees on.[3]
